Abstract

A rib-like land section partitioned by main grooves, a plurality of sub-grooves provided in the rib-like land section at intervals in the tire circumferential direction and a groove hole provided between the sub-grooves adjacent to each other and extending in the tire circumferential direction are provided in a tread section. The sub-groove includes a lateral groove portion, in which one end opens to the main groove and the other end terminates inside the rib-like land section, and a longitudinal groove portion extending from the other end of the lateral groove portion to one side in the tire circumferential direction and terminating inside the rib-like land section. The groove hole is formed so that a groove depth at one end part close to a terminal end of the longitudinal groove portion becomes shallower than a groove depth at the other end part far from the terminal end.

Claims (20)

1. A pneumatic tire comprising:

a main groove provided in a tread section and extending in a tire circumferential direction;

a rib-like land section partitioned by the main groove and extending in the tire circumferential direction;

a plurality of sub-grooves provided in the rib-like land section at intervals in the tire circumferential direction; and

a groove hole provided between the sub-grooves adjacent to each other in the tire circumferential direction and extending in the tire circumferential direction, wherein

each of the plurality of sub-grooves includes a lateral groove portion extending in a tire width direction, in which one end opens to the main groove and the other end terminates inside the rib-like land section, and a longitudinal groove portion extending from the other end of the lateral groove portion to one side in the tire circumferential direction and terminating inside the rib-like land section,

the groove hole is formed so that a groove depth at one end part close to a terminal end of the longitudinal groove portion becomes shallower than a groove depth at the other end part far from the terminal end,

a plurality of convex portions or concave portions are arranged side by side in the tire circumferential direction on a bottom surface of the groove hole,

the bottom surface of the groove hole is formed in an inclined surface shape so that the groove depth of the groove hole becomes gradually shallower from the other end part toward the one end part, and

the groove holes are provided such that only one groove hole is provided in each land section part sandwiched between the sub-grooves adjacent to each other in the tire circumferential direction.
